The Red Centre of Australia is an almost surreal landscape. The colours are the richest of reds and the sky can be more cobalt than any paint tries to imitate. Visiting the areas around Uluru and Kata Tjuta took me almost to another world and this painting has that other worldly whimsical feel. Although the painting represents the area it attempts to capture the landscape as an impression rather than realism. The trees and rock formations are semi abstract adding to the whimsy.

Medium

The Pthalo Blue, Cobalt and Violet acrylic on canvas forms the dark, brilliant background for the splendour of the red monolith formations, rocks and whimsical trees and foliage. The painting has a little texture which gives the impression of the layers of rock and weathering over millions of years.
